
Starting this Friday, May 15, motorists visiting the City of Rehoboth Beach will need to pay for parking as the seasonal fee period begins, continuing through September 15. Costs remain unchanged from previous years, with visitors able to choose between meter payments, the ParkMobile application, or purchasing permits.
Essential Parking Guidelines:
All angled parking spaces require head-in positioning, while parallel parking must follow traffic flow direction. When using meters or the ParkMobile system, drivers must enter complete license plate information, including all letters and numbers such as the PC designation found on Delaware plates.
Meter Payment Details:
Parking meters operate from 10 am through 10 pm every day, charging $4 per hour as in past seasons. Drivers can pay using cash or cards at the meter itself or through the ParkMobile application. The meter system operates by zones rather than individual spaces, with zone markings displayed on meters and within the mobile app. Even 30-minute parking areas require payment.
Mobile App Guidelines:
First-time visitors should download the ParkMobile app before arriving. Users need to store their vehicle and complete license plate details in the system, ensuring they select the correct vehicle if multiple are saved. The app allows time extensions without returning to the parked car.
Permit Information:
Parking permits are valid from 10 am to 5 pm daily and come in various options: daily, weekly, weekend, seasonal, and scooter permits. Permits are available at the Parking Building or kiosks located at 409 Rehoboth Ave and the 700 block of Bayard Ave. However, permits cannot be used in metered spaces, which still require meter payment.
Parking Facility Details:
The Convention Center parking lot serves as the city’s only municipal lot, where drivers use the central meter or ParkMobile app. Other lots operate independently from the city and don’t accept ParkMobile, meaning parking violations in those areas fall outside city jurisdiction.
New Bandstand Area Rules:
This season introduces changes to the Bandstand Horseshoe parking zone. Meters in this area will require payment from 10:00am to 6:00pm, with payment restrictions after 6:00pm. These modified hours apply on Fridays, Saturdays, and Sundays from Memorial Day through Labor Day, specifically when concerts are scheduled. The area maintains designated lanes for DART and Jolley Trolley services, plus one lane for handicap drop-off and ride-sharing services.
Finding Permit vs. Meter Zones:
The city’s parking map, accessible on their website, shows metered zones highlighted in orange. All remaining streets are designated for permit parking.
Additional Beach Rules:
Coinciding with the parking season start, dogs are prohibited on the beach and boardwalk beginning Friday. Bicycle access on the boardwalk is restricted to 5:00am through 10:00am only.
